canyin-project/ybcy/models/common/Drag.php

41 lines
16 KiB
PHP
Raw Permalink Normal View History

2024-11-01 16:07:54 +08:00
<?php
namespace app\models\common;
use Yii;
use yii\db\ActiveRecord;
class Drag extends ActiveRecord{
//获取默认拖拽数据
public static function getDefault($uniacid,$page){
$row=(new \yii\db\Query())
->from('{{%ybwm_drag}}')
->where('page=:page AND display=1 AND deleteAt=0 AND uniacid=:uniacid',[':page'=>$page,':uniacid'=>$uniacid])
->one();
if(!$row){
if($page==1){
$name='默认首页';
}
if($page==2){
$name='默认个人中心';
}
$data['name']=$name;
$data['page']=$page;
$data['display']=1;
$data['createdAt']=time();
$data['uniacid']=$uniacid;
$data['body']=self::defaultIndex($page);
Yii::$app->db->createCommand()->insert('{{%ybwm_drag}}', $data)->execute();
}
}
//默认页面
public static function defaultIndex($page){
if($page==1){
return '{"list":[{"title":"\u56fa\u5b9a\u5b9a\u4f4d","name":"fixed","styles":{"module":"4","orPic":"2","isFloat":"2","marginTop":0,"marginBottom":0,"marginLeft":"0","marginRight":"0","percent":80,"colorBg":"#fff","colorWord":"#343434","circle":"0","imgUrl":[{"url":{"params":"platform","name":{"id":"navigation","name":"\u95e8\u5e97\u5bfc\u822a"},"category":"\u5e73\u53f0\u9996\u9875"},"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/29\/202101291523112202.png"},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/29\/202101291531163792.jpg","url":{"params":"platform","name":{"id":"cashier","name":"\u6536\u94f6\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/29\/202101291531218227.jpg","url":{"params":"platform","name":{"id":"goods","name":"\u70b9\u5355\u9875"},"category":"\u5e73\u53f0\u9996\u9875"}}],"upLoad1":{"text":"","img":"","url":""},"upLoad2":{"text":"","img":"","url":""},"floatUrl1":{"text":"\u4e0b\u5355\u514d\u6392\u961f","img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/29\/202101291524066982.png","url":{"params":"platform","name":{"id":"TakeFood","name":"\u81ea\u53d6"},"category":"\u5e73\u53f0\u9996\u9875"}},"floatUrl2":{"text":"\u65e0\u63a5\u89e6\u914d\u9001","img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/29\/202101291524288505.png","url":{"params":"platform","name":{"id":"takeOutFood","name":"\u5916\u5356"},"category":"\u5e73\u53f0\u9996\u9875"}},"marginLR":0}},{"title":"\u70ed\u533a","name":"hot","styles":{"marginTop":0,"marginBottom":0,"marginLeft":"0","marginRight":"0","circle":0,"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2021\/01\/04\/202101041010568105.png","divStyles":[{"width":"358","height":"164","sX":" 0","sY":" 0","status":true,"url":"{\"params\":\"platform\",\"name\":{\"id\":\"scanOrder\",\"name\":\"\u626b\u7801\u70b9\u9910\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u626b\u7801\u70b9\u9910"},{"width":"348","height":"164","sX":" 392","sY":" 0","status":true,"url":"{\"params\":\"platform\",\"name\":{\"id\":\"fastOrder\",\"name\":\"\u5feb\u9910\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u5feb\u9910"},{"width":"740","height":"154","sX":" 0","sY":" 190","status":true,"url":"{\"params\":\"platform\",\"name\":{\"id\":\"navigation\",\"name\":\"\u95e8\u5e97\u5bfc\u822a\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u95e8\u5e97\u5bfc\u822a"}],"marginLR":20}},{"title":"\u70ed\u533a","name":"hot","styles":{"marginTop":0,"marginBottom":0,"marginLeft":"0","marginRight":"0","circle":0,"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261425015411.png","divStyles":[{"width":"334","height":"193","sX":" 25","sY":" 7","status":"true","url":"{\"params\":\"platform\",\"name\":{\"id\":\"collectionCourtesy\",\"name\":\"\u6536\u85cf\u6709\u793c\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u6536\u85cf\u6709\u793c"},{"width":"335","height":"193","sX":" 371","sY":" 7","status":"true","url":"{\"params\":\"platform\",\"name\":{\"id\":\"couponCenter\",\"name\":\"\u9886\u5238\u4e2d\u5fc3\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u9886\u5238\u4e2d\u5fc3"},{"width":"546","height":"105","sX":" 18","sY":" 236","status":"true","url":"{\"params\":\"platform\",\"name\":{\"id\":\"integralShop\",\"name\":\"\u79ef\u5206\u5546\u57ce\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u79ef\u5206\u5546\u57ce"},{"width":"96","height":"102","sX":" 608","sY":" 237","status":"true","url":"{\"params\":\"platform\",\"name\":{\"id\":\"signIndex\",\"name\":\"\u7b7e\u5230\u4e2d\u5fc3\"},\"category\":\"\u5e73\u53f0\u9996\u9875\"}","name":"\u7b7e\u5230\u4e2d\u5fc3"}],"marginLR":0}},{"title":"\u5546\u54c1\u7ec4","name":"product","styles":{"type":"1","typeBg":"1","colorBg":"rgba(0, 0, 0, 0)","img":"","typeBtn":"2","typePay":"-1","typeText":"\u63a8\u8350","colorBtn":"#ff0303","colorProductBg":"#fff","colorTitle":"#212121","marginTop":0,"marginBottom":0,"marginLeft":"0","marginRight":"0","typeProduct":"3","productName":[{"params":"product","name":{"id":"105","name":"\u8292\u8292\u7518\u9732\u6930\u6930\u51bb"
}
if($page==2){
return '{"list":[{"title":"\u4f1a\u5458\u4fe1\u606f","name":"vip","styles":{"bgType":"2","colorBg":"#FF3C29","img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261426508054.png","colorName":"#333333","btnStatus":[true,false,false,true],"colorNumber":"#212121","colorTitle":"#212121","colorBorder":"#eee","vipStatus":"1"}},{"title":"\u6309\u94ae\u7ec42","name":"btn2","styles":{"num":"4","marginTop":10,"marginBottom":0,"circle":10,"colorBg":"#FFFFFF","colorWord":"#2c2c2c","title":"\u670d\u52a1\u529f\u80fd","arrange":"1","fontSize":12,"width":20,"btnList":[{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261427448518.png","word":"\u6211\u7684\u5730\u5740","url":{"params":"platform","name":{"id":"myAddress","name":"\u6211\u7684\u5730\u5740"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261428012995.png","word":"\u6536\u85cf\u6709\u793c","url":{"params":"platform","name":{"id":"collectionCourtesy","name":"\u6536\u85cf\u6709\u793c"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261428234115.png","word":"\u6211\u7684\u8ba2\u5355","url":{"params":"platform","name":{"id":"myOrder","name":"\u6211\u7684\u8ba2\u5355"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261428403272.png","word":"\u8d44\u8baf\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"information","name":"\u8d44\u8baf\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261429143212.png","word":"\u5145\u503c\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"balanceRecharge","name":"\u5145\u503c\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261430002716.png","word":"\u76f4\u64ad\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"live","name":"\u76f4\u64ad\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261429449791.png","word":"\u9886\u5238\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"couponCenter","name":"\u9886\u5238\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261430332320.png","word":"\u7b7e\u5230\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"signIndex","name":"\u7b7e\u5230\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261430481893.png","word":"\u79ef\u5206\u5546\u57ce","url":{"params":"platform","name":{"id":"integralShop","name":"\u79ef\u5206\u5546\u57ce"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261431414610.png","word":"\u8054\u7cfb\u5ba2\u670d","url":{"params":"platform","name":{"id":"contactCustomer","name":"\u8054\u7cfb\u5ba2\u670d"},"category":"\u5e73\u53f0\u9996\u9875"}}],"marginLR":10}},{"title":"\u6309\u94ae\u7ec42","name":"btn2","styles":{"num":"4","marginTop":"10","marginBottom":"0","circle":"10","colorBg":"#FFFFFF","colorWord":"#2c2c2c","title":"\u66f4\u591a\u529f\u80fd","arrange":"2","fontSize":"12","width":"20","btnList":[{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261432483867.png","word":"\u5173\u4e8e\u6211\u4eec","url":{"params":"platform","name":{"id":"aboutUs","name":"\u5173\u4e8e\u6211\u4eec"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261433135979.png","word":"\u5e2e\u52a9\u4e2d\u5fc3","url":{"params":"platform","name":{"id":"helpCenter","name":"\u5e2e\u52a9\u4e2d\u5fc3"},"category":"\u5e73\u53f0\u9996\u9875"}},{"img":"https:\/\/img.b-ke.cn\/yb_wm\/16\/2020\/11\/26\/202011261433374539.png","word":"\u5546\u52a1\u5408\u4f5c","url":{"params":"platform","name":{"id":"contactCustomer","name":"\u8054\u7cfb\u5ba2\u670d"},"category":"\u5e73\u53f0\u9996\u9875"}}],"marginLR":"10"}}],"pageSetting":[{"title":"\u9875\u9762\u8bbe\u7f6e","name":"nameless","sty
}
return '';
}
}